The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Emma Cox, born in 1827 in Liverpool, Lancashire, consisted of 4 members. Emma was the head of the household, widow. She had 1 child; Philip Arthur, born 1866 in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household were Emma's Servant, Anne (born 1839 in Liverpool, Lancashire, England) and Emma's Servant, Jane (born 1860 in Lilleshall, Shropshire, England).
